Montenegro’s Prime Minister Milojko Spajić stated that he fully agrees the European Union should be the final destination for the entire Western Balkans.

However, Spajić emphasized that Montenegro expects to be ready to join the EU by 2028, noting that he hopes Serbia and other regional candidates will speed up their integration efforts.

He wrote this on X (formerly Twitter), referencing an earlier statement by Serbian President Aleksandar Vučić, who announced he would propose to European Commission President Ursula von der Leyen that the entire Western Balkans should join the EU together.

Vučić made the remarks during the Beltalks Forum – Belgrade Economic Talks, where he also announced a significant meeting in Brussels with von der Leyen and Antonio Costa.

According to Vučić, a collective accession of the Western Balkans is the “best idea”, arguing that leaving any country behind would create strategic and political challenges.
“Everyone will feel better — Albanians, Bosnians, and others. I keep hearing only positive reactions to this idea,” Vučić said, adding that he would present the proposal during today’s discussions in Brussels.
